That ship looks really cool, well done.

There's just one thing I'd like to say about it: The Parenting and Childing is a bit screwed up.

As what I mean with this: If you destroy a section attached to 2 other sections, the other two sections will stay untouched, meaning one piece of the ship will just drift ''attached'' to your ship in space.

To fix this: Either start another ship, because fixing this will be a hell job to do, or remove the first piece, connect it to the core, then remove the piece adjecent to it, select that piece and replace the piece you just removed.
